The My Little Pony Phenomenon

My Little Pony, a franchise owned by Hasbro, has been enchanting audiences since the early 1980s. It all began with a line of toy ponies, each with their own unique design and personality, catering primarily to young girls. However, it didn’t take long for the characters to leap off the shelves and onto the television screen.

The Magic Series

In the mid-80s, My Little Pony received its own animated television series. This marked the beginning of the “magic series,” which would introduce the world to a vibrant array of characters. Each represents the values of friendship, kindness, and understanding. These early episodes of My Little Pony set the foundation for what the franchise would become. A source of life lessons, moral values, and endless entertainment are all topics it would encompass.

The Cutie Mark Crusaders (CMC)

CMC is a group of young, enthusiastic characters in the MLP series. They embark on a quest to discover their own unique “cutie marks, which are symbolic representations of their individual talents and special abilities.

The CMC consists of three main characters:

  1. Apple Bloom: Apple Bloom is a young Earth Pony and a member of the Apple family. She is known for her hardworking nature and is often seen helping out on Sweet Apple Acres. Apple Bloom is the sister of Applejack, one of the show’s main characters.
  2. Sweetie Belle: Sweetie Belle is a Unicorn with a passion for singing and is the younger sister of Rarity. Rarity is another prominent character in the series. Her voice is enchanting, and she dreams of finding her true talent.
  3. Scootaloo: Scootaloo is a Pegasus pony who is known for her fearless and adventurous nature. She aspires to be a skilled flier and is often seen riding her scooter. Scootaloo is enthusiastic about finding her cutie mark.

The CMC forms a close-knit friendship as they work together to understand their unique talents. They engage in various adventures and activities as they search for their special cutie marks. While their initial efforts often result in humorous mishaps, their determination, and perseverance illustrate the value of friendship and self-discovery. Throughout the series, they provide valuable life lessons and inspire viewers to embrace their individuality and not be discouraged by temporary setbacks.

As the series progresses, the Cutie Mark Crusaders become more prominent characters, and each of them eventually discovers their special talents. This is how they earn their own unique cutie marks. This development reflects the overarching theme of self-discovery and personal growth that runs throughout My Little Pony. The CMC’s journey is a testament to the importance of perseverance and the support of friends.

Rainbow Dash: The Element of Loyalty

Among the new generation of characters, Rainbow Dash stands out as a fan favorite. Known for her vibrant colors and striking blue mane, Rainbow Dash embodies the Element of Loyalty. Her loyalty to her friends is unwavering, and she often finds herself in situations that require her to put her friends’ needs before her own. Rainbow Dash teaches us the importance of standing by those we care about, even in the face of adversity.

Twilight Sparkle: The Element of Magic

Twilight Sparkle, another central character in the series, represents the Element of Magic. As the diligent student of Princess Celestia, she constantly seeks to broaden her knowledge and deepen her understanding of magic. Her journey is one of self-discovery, and she learns that true magic isn’t just about spells and incantations; it’s about the magic of friendship. Twilight Sparkle reminds us that the pursuit of knowledge and growth is an essential part of life.

Pinkie Pie: The Element of Laughter

Pinkie Pie, a bubbly and energetic pony, embodies the Element of Laughter. Her whimsical personality and infectious laughter bring joy to the lives of everyone around her. Pinkie Pie teaches us that laughter is a universal language, and it’s essential to find joy in the little things. Her carefree attitude encourages us to appreciate the humor in everyday situations.

Andrea Libman: The Voice Behind the Ponies

Behind the animated characters of My Little Pony, there are talented voice actors who bring them to life. Andrea Libman is one of these talented individuals. She voices both Pinkie Pie and Fluttershy, two beloved characters in the series. Her portrayal of Pinkie Pie’s exuberance and Fluttershy’s gentle nature has endeared these characters to fans worldwide. Powerpuff Girls and Tara Strong

The influence of My Little Pony also extends to other popular animated series. Notably, Tara Strong, who voices Twilight Sparkle in the new generation of the show, is also known for her iconic role as Bubbles in “The Powerpuff Girls.” The ability to captivate audiences across multiple series demonstrates the talent of the voice actors and the enduring appeal of these beloved characters.
